His is the most effective guidance, as it preserves the health, completes satisfaction, and acquires the goals that this activity was meant to achieve. Sexual intercourse was meant to achieve three essential goals: (1) Reproduction and the preservation of mankind until the number of souls that Allaah has ordered to come to this world is fulfilled and completed. (2) Expelling the water (semen), which would cause harm if it remains inside the body. (3) Satisfying sexual desire and enjoying sex and the bounty it represents.
